In recent weeks, Los Leones have displayed variable form, alternating between moments of brilliance and periods of disconnection. While the team has maintained defensive solidity, the transition from defense to attack has left much to be desired, causing Athletic to rely excessively on individual plays rather than cohesive collective gameplay.
One of the main areas for improvement is the offensive transition. Athletic, traditionally known for their direct and vertical play, has struggled to move the ball quickly from defense to attack. Players often find themselves caught in midfield, allowing opposing teams to organize defensively. Implementing a shorter, more precise passing game, especially in intermediate zones, could facilitate the creation of opportunities before the rival defense can close ranks.
Additionally, the utilization of wingers is crucial. While Iñaki Williams and Nico Williams have been effective in one-on-one situations, there has been a noticeable lack of support on the flanks. Encouraging greater movement from the full-backs into the attack, creating numerical superiority in the wings, could open up spaces in the opponent's defense. This would not only allow the wingers to have more passing options but could also generate clearer goal-scoring situations.
Defensively, the team has shown solidity, but the Leones need to be more proactive in high pressing. Instead of retreating after losing the ball, Athletic could benefit from a more aggressive recovery approach, pressuring opposing defenders in their own half. This type of tactic can provoke errors from the adversary and maintain constant pressure, favoring a more dynamic game.
Finally, game tempo management is vital. Often, Athletic has fallen into the trap of playing at a frenetic pace, leading to rushed decisions. Seeking moments to slow down the game and maintain possession could help control the tempo and allow the team to reposition, thus creating clearer opportunities to finish.
In summary, adjustments in offensive transition, winger utilization, high pressing, and game tempo management are essential for Athletic Bilbao to enhance their performance and stay competitive in La Liga. With these changes, Los Leones could once again showcase their distinctive playing style and reach their maximum potential.
